VEDA (Visualization, Expedition and Data Analysis) is an ingenious platform empowering researchers to check out and evaluate Planet science data in the cloud. By combining interactive storytelling with open science principles, VEDA enables researchers to involve brand-new target markets and share their analysis results properly. Established through a collaboration in between NASA EFFECT, Development Seed, College of Alabama in Huntsville, Aspect 84, Indiana University, International Interactive Computer Collaboration (2 i 2 c), Planet Scientific Research Data and Details System (ESDIS) Task, NASA Science Managed Cloud Setting (SMCE), and NASA Goal Cloud Platform (MCP), VEDA considerably reduces the obstacles to accessing Planet scientific research data and the computational sources needed for checking out and processing the petabyte-scale Planet information archives in the cloud. VEDA’s accomplishment exemplifies the core principles of NASA’s Open-Source Science Effort (OSSI) , showcasing dedication to promoting clear, obtainable, and collaborative scientific research study.

In the springtime of 2020, as the COVID- 19 pandemic clutched the globe, the structure for the VEDA Control panel was laid. With much of the globe’s populace urged to stay home, scientists saw brand-new and intriguing adjustments in the worldwide atmosphere. Earth-observing satellites, instruments aboard the International Space Station, airborne projects, and ground observations kept track of modifications in carbon dioxide, water high quality, nighttime lights, agriculture, and nitrogen dioxide. To share the modifications observed, a trilateral effort with NASA, the European Space Firm (ESA), and the Japan Aerospace Exploration Firm (JAXA) was generated to create the Earth Observing (EO) Control panel– a successful display of how cooperation in between agencies can advance scientific research for all. At the very same time, NASA produced the COVID- 19 Control panel , which gives public access to observations made using Planet observation satellite information. The dashboard illustrates changes in the global environment and socio-economic tasks prior to and after the pandemic.

Influenced by the COVID- 19 Control panel, VEDA was formally launched in the spring of 2022, increasing the exploration and data evaluation abilities. “The VEDA Dashboard’s datasets and stores are configured by means of VEDA’s core SpatioTemporal Asset Catalog (STAC) Researchers configure scrollytelling stories with interactive maps and text without composing code,” shares Aimee Barciauskas, Development Seed Data Designer and technological specialist on the VEDA Influence Group. The trilateral EO Control panel makes use of NASA data directly from the VEDA system, minimizing redundancy and making future updates easier.

Flexible and extensible information solutions are important for offering the analytics platform in VEDA. The analytics system is a joint computing environment for science scientists to explore NASA Planet scientific research information and data added by scientists leveraging the VEDA platform. The Planet Info Systems (EIS) science groups deal with VEDA designers to expand the scale of their science. For example, VEDA and EIS teams scaled the EIS active fire tracking and predictions from California to the continental united state and automated keeping track of to run every 12 hours.

VEDA’s configurable and reusable cloud infrastructure packages are built entirely from open-source software. This component diagram shows VEDA’s core implementation, which includes a central publication database serving APIs for search and discovery and tiling tools for web dashboards and hosted analysis hubs.

Along with its technological innovations, VEDA is proactively promoting an independent recreation center around the system. This area harmonizes efforts with the Multi-Mission Formula and Analysis Platform (MAAP) and the U.S. Greenhouse Gas Keeping an eye on Facility, ensuring seamless control and synergy. “Just recently, the VEDA system was utilized to carry out an IEEE-led summer season institution session on data scientific research. To promote knowledge sharing and best techniques, future plans include hosting focused workshops, lining up with the Transform to Open Up Science (TOPS) initiative,” states Dr. Manil Maskey, the visionary behind the VEDA platform. In addition, a VEDA area forum will be developed to facilitate the exchange of concepts and experience on interoperability, open-source software program, and cloud-native services both within and outside of NASA.

The most recent effort to utilize VEDA is the U.S. Greenhouse Gas (GHG) Checking Center data and information system, arranged for launch later on this summer season in 2023 By utilizing VEDA’s existing structure, designers can swiftly and efficiently construct the brand-new site without starting from scratch. This method simplifies the growth procedure and ensures a seamless transition. The U.S. GHG Facility is a joint initiative between 4 agencies, particularly NASA (National Aeronautics and Room Administration), EPA (the Epa), NOAA (National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ration), and NIST (National Institute of Criteria and Technology). With the possible to integrate payments from additional firms, state federal governments, and non-public organizations, the united state GHG Facility emphasizes the value of collaboration and data-driven solutions in dealing with greenhouse gas monitoring difficulties.
